Transaction 8507786da9ec72e2d33a4beff4262e7ee2b32092466a76b18c1616f03c664d38
1 Input
1 Output
-
8507786da9ec72e2d33a4beff4262e7ee2b32092466a76b18c1616f03c664d38:0
- value
- 2361769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 521ec60d368ee26550a49b8e609648661cd0d253 OP_EQUAL
- address
- 39BECTrQWHDotuAmmA8GABF9FFWAX6ALda